Drainage Ditch Excavation in Houston, TX
Drainage ditch excavation services involve the careful removal and shaping of soil to create effective channels for managing excess water on residential properties. These projects typically include constructing new drainage ditches, improving existing ones, or modifying landscape features to ensure proper water flow away from foundations, lawns, and gardens. Homeowners often seek this service to prevent water pooling, reduce flooding risks, and protect landscaping or structures from water damage,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or poor natural drainage.
Property owners considering drainage ditch excavation should understand the importance of proper planning and site assessment before beginning work. It's helpful to know the specific drainage issues present, the desired water flow direction, and any local regulations or permits that may apply. Clear communication about the scope of the project can help ensure the excavation effectively addresses drainage concerns and integrates well with the property's landscape.

Drainage Ditch Excavation Questions
What is drainage ditch excavation used for? It helps manage water flow around properties, preventing flooding and soil erosion by creating proper drainage channels.
When should drainage ditches be excavated? Excavation is typically needed when standing water or erosion issues are observed, or during property improvements requiring improved drainage.
What types of projects benefit from drainage ditch excavation? Projects such as yard grading, foundation protection, and landscape drainage improvements often require excavation services.
What should property owners consider before excavation? Ensuring proper planning for water flow and understanding the layout of existing underground utilities can help achieve effective drainage solutions.
